Vermont Railway
Vermont Railway is a family of railroads (Vermont Railway, Green Mountain Railway and Clarendon & Pittsford Railroad) in Vermont and New York State that
share the same radio system. HQ is in Burlington Vermont, with Dispatch services in Rutland Vermont.
